Just how much does an auto accident attorney cost upfront?
Many reliable Auto Accident Injury Lawyer accident attorneys do not charge anything in advance. They deal with a contingency cost basis, normally taking an agreed-upon percentage (typically 33% to 40%) of the final settlement or court award. If they do not win the case, the client owes no attorney charges.
2. The length of time do I have to submit a claim after an auto accident?
This depends on the state where the accident took place. The statute of restrictions usually ranges from one to three years from the date of the accident. Waiting too long can permanently surrender the right to seek settlement.
3. Should I speak with the other motorist’s insurer?
It is strongly advised not to give a tape-recorded declaration or sign any documents from the opposing insurer without speaking with a lawyer initially. Anything you state can be used versus you to decrease the value of or deny your claim.
4. What if I was partially at fault for the accident?
Lots of states operate under relative negligence laws. This means that even if you were partly to blame (e.g., 20% at fault), you might still be able to recover compensation, though your total payment will usually be lowered by your percentage of fault.
